2,2,4,6,7-PENTAMETHYL-1,2-DIHYDRO-QUINOLINE

Description:
2,2,4,6,7-Pentamethyl-1,2-dihydroquinoline, with the CAS number 716-51-8, is an organic compound belonging to the class of quinolines, which are bicyclic compounds containing a fused benzene and pyridine ring. This particular compound is characterized by its five methyl groups attached to the quinoline structure, which significantly influences its physical and chemical properties. It typically appears as a yellow to brown liquid or solid, depending on its purity and form. The presence of multiple methyl groups enhances its hydrophobicity and can affect its solubility in various solvents. Additionally, 2,2,4,6,7-pentamethyl-1,2-dihydroquinoline exhibits interesting chemical reactivity, making it a subject of study in organic synthesis and materials science. Its unique structure may also impart specific biological activities, although detailed studies on its biological properties may be limited. Overall, this compound is of interest in both academic research and potential industrial applications due to its distinctive characteristics.
Formula:C14H19N
